Output d9584cde689fae53b9f490ea1eaaad5e2d479cf399a3440c8c27b52e77e565ea:24
- value
- 1031836
- script pubkey
- OP_0 OP_PUSHBYTES_20 1fefb0e5f5439bd00af513e98df6cdea5a19f40e
- address
- bc1qrlhmpe04gwdaqzh4z05cmakdafdpnaqwy7vp0d
- transaction
- d9584cde689fae53b9f490ea1eaaad5e2d479cf399a3440c8c27b52e77e565ea